Output f6af28b1a34663592401f80ffd23e2edd76d03b42d9444ccf10a9806bdbf637f:1

value
1257086
script pubkey
OP_0 OP_PUSHBYTES_20 3d36b6ed7bd598dbc762648ca663012beb5f8d6b
address
bc1q85mtdmtm6kvdh3mzvjx2vccp9044lrttrqeh9w
transaction
f6af28b1a34663592401f80ffd23e2edd76d03b42d9444ccf10a9806bdbf637f
confirmations
38558
spent
true